Sigur Ros ( )
This album, from my personal experience, has been the hardest to rate thus far. That is, this is the most subjective music I've ever heard. The album tends to be as good as I feel like making it. One listen it will sound amazing, the next listen I just hear boring piano riffs and some gibberish singing. That being said, this album is unique in the sense that it is open to more interpretation than any other music I know of. This is both the beauty and the flaw of ( ). The title of the album is quite fitting, as though the listener can fill the parentheses with whatever seems fit at the time. Maybe that's the genious of it, that the album's enjoyment is up to the listener.

Charles Bronson Complete Discocrappy
This is punk in the most raw form possible. It somehow finds a way to strip down punk even more than it already is. Extremely short, fast, in-your-face songs filled with samples and spoken words in between. Charles Bronson are about as good as powerviolence gets. This is perhaps the only album and/or compilation with 100+ songs on it that I can listen to all the way through.r
